Originally Posted by ramcosca
Right now it's 66% to 33%...
2 out of every 3 owners prefer Manual :wink:
That general statement is most likely not true at all. The demographics of this website are completely different than the general populace - and this poll is definately not scientific. I'd be willing to bet that if a scientific study were done for the population at large, the numbers would be reversed.

It's important to remember where the data is being collected from when looking at statistics.
